3. Types of Portable Solar Energy Devices
Understanding the different types of portable solar devices is crucial to selecting the right system for your needs. Below are the main categories you will encounter:
3.1 Solar Panels
Portable solar panels come in various sizes, ranging from small chargers for personal devices to larger panels capable of powering RVs or homes. They convert sunlight into electricity efficiently and can be set up anywhere the sun shines.
3.2 Solar Chargers
Perfect for on-the-go lifestyles, solar chargers are compact devices designed to recharge smartphones, tablets, and other electronic gadgets. They are lightweight and often equipped with USB ports for convenience.
3.3 Solar Generators
Solar generators combine solar panels with a battery storage system, enabling users to store energy for later use. They provide a reliable power source for appliances, tools, and even emergency backup during power outages.

6. Installation and Setup of Portable Solar Systems
Setting up a portable solar system is generally straightforward. Below is a step-by-step guide:
6.1 Location Selection
Choose a clear, unobstructed area with maximum sun exposure, ideally facing south for optimal solar gain.
6.2 Assembling the Equipment
Follow the manufacturer's instructions to assemble the solar panels and connect any necessary components, such as batteries or inverters.
6.3 Positioning the Panels
Adjust the angle of the solar panels for optimal sunlight absorption, typically around 30 degrees for maximum efficiency.
6.4 Testing the System
After setup, test the system by connecting your devices and ensuring they receive an adequate charge.
7. Maintenance Tips for Longevity
To ensure your portable solar energy system lasts as long as possible, consider the following maintenance tips:
7.1 Regular Cleaning
Dust and debris can reduce solar panel efficiency. Clean them regularly with a soft cloth and water to maintain optimal performance.
7.2 Inspect Connections
Check all connections and cables periodically for wear and tear to prevent potential electrical issues.
7.3 Monitor Performance
Keep an eye on the system’s performance to identify any significant drops in efficiency, which may indicate a need for maintenance or repairs.

9. Frequently Asked Questions
9.1 What is portable solar energy?
Portable solar energy refers to systems designed to generate electricity from sunlight and can be easily transported and set up in various locations.
9.2 How long do portable solar chargers take to charge devices?
The charging time varies depending on the device's battery capacity and the solar charger's power output, usually ranging from a few hours to a full day.
9.3 Can I use portable solar energy indoors?
While portable solar systems are primarily designed for outdoor use, they can function indoors if placed near a window with ample sunlight.
9.4 Are portable solar generators noisy?
No, portable solar generators operate silently, making them ideal for quiet environments such as camping sites or homes.
9.5 How much do portable solar energy systems cost?
The cost of portable solar energy systems varies widely based on capacity and features, with simple solar chargers starting at around $50 and comprehensive solar generators costing several hundred dollars.
